CB Richard Ellis grows EMEA Retail team by 25% (UK)

CB Richard Ellis is continuing to strengthen its international retail capability in response to growing client cross-border demand across Europe, Middle East and Africa (EMEA). The team, which is now 180 strong, has seen a 25% increase in the last year. Recent highlights include a new Head of Retail for Central and Eastern Europe (CEE), the addition of a high profile retail team in CBRE Germany, and a new retail dedicated European research group.

Peter Fraunhoffer joins CBRE in a new Head of Retail role for CEE. Fraunhoffer has spent the last 11 years looking after the CEE region for German shoe retailer, Deichmann, and brings with him an unmatched understanding of the retail business. His appointment will help to satisfy growing demand from retailers and owners for better multi-market benchmarking across CEE, to help understand the relative strengths of each country.

The company has also increased its retail expertise in a number of high growth CEE local markets with new appointments in Slovakia, Poland, Hungary, Czech Republic and Russia. The region continues to represent an important growth engine for CBRE as ever more retailers look to expand East.

There have also been a series of new retail appointments in major Western European hubs. This includes the recent addition of five new recruits to CBRE Germany's retail team. All five individuals were previously at Jones Lang LaSalle and include Christian-Philipp Hass, who will be based in Hamburg and will head up Retail Agency North, and Frank Emmerich, who will head up Retail Agency West from CBRE's Dusseldorf office.

CBRE Germany's growing retail capability is now country-wide stretching across Frankfurt, Hamburg, Berlin, Dusseldorf and Munich, and includes retail agency, shopping center management and consulting. Dusseldorf is of particular importance as it focuses on the important Rhine-Ruhr area, which enjoys the highest population density in Germany.

Other CBRE appointments across Western Europe include new retail specialists in Spain, the Netherlands, Italy and Portugal.

To further enhance its cross-border offer, CBRE has also created a new EMEA-wide retail research capability. The group is lead by Jonathan Riches, who was appointed as Head of EMEA Retail Research earlier in the year. The latest addition is Sven Buchsteiner, who joins CBRE Germany as Head of Retail research, from DTZ. The group co-ordinates with CBRE US and Asia, to offer insight into the implications of changing market dynamics across the world for retailers and owners.
